Bug: black zones as rectangles appear when reading PDFs

Open moshpirit opened this issue 3 years ago • 4 comments

For few months I've been seeing black rectangles appearing in the PDFs

Here are some screenshots using the same PDF and most of them with the same pages:

As you can see, the rectangles change their position and form from view to view and it's really annoying. I'm very surprised no one reported this already.


Librera PRO (F-droid) v. 8.4.44-fdroid on Android 10 with "Book view" and I use dark mode with my phone but light theme on Librera. Feel free to ask for more info

I did, and it happens with the new version too, with and without importing my settings. I noticed though that it only happens with the dark theme on Android and the scroll mode. It did not happen with either Android's white theme or book mode or musician mode, nor dark mode on Librera. So it seems like it's just a refresh problem that has to do with how the app deals with using a white theme when Android says dark, and it has to load a PDF faster than what it does with the other 2 reading modes (book and musician).
